Molten Spartan South Midlands Division One
Tokyngton Manor 3 Harpenden Town 3
TWO second half goals denied Harpenden Town all three points from their trip to Tokyngton Manor.
The hosts opened the deadlock after 20 minutes when they took advantage of a defensive mix up to tap home.
The goal sparked Town into life and they equalised when Jimmy Warner beat his marker to head home James Ewington's cross.
Town made it 2-1 when Chris Gregory hit a close range volley that bobbled under the keeper.

The visitors were rampant and scored again from a corner when Jack Cartwright headed home.
The second half was a different story and Tokyngton reduced the deficit from the penalty spot after captain Saul was adjudged to have handled.
The home side equalised when Harpenden failed to clear their lines and a Manor midfielder fired home.
Both sides had chances to win the game but neither could find a winner..
Town: J Gregory, Shaw, Cartwright, Saul (c), Crabtree, Taaffe, Turkentine, Jeffrey, Ewington, C Gregory, Warner. Subs: Dawes, Tom, Chapman.
